Summary     : Tool for finding memory management bugs in programs
Description :
Valgrind is a tool to help you find memory-management problems in your
programs. When a program is run under Valgrind's supervision, all
reads and writes of memory are checked, and calls to
malloc/new/free/delete are intercepted. As a result, Valgrind can
detect a lot of problems that are otherwise very hard to
find/diagnose.
